The wireless controller displays
PUSH OK WHEN YOU FIND YOUR INPUT.
The input label is displayed in the
bottom line (for example, Input 1).
8.
Press Scroll Left ( ) or Scroll
Right ( ) to find the input you
want to choose. Each time you
press Scroll Left ( ) or Scroll
Right ( ), the wireless controller
transmits an input signal to your
stereo. When your stereo goes to
the correct input for Sirius, press
OK. For example, if you
connected the SIRIUS SC-H1W
tuner to the SAT input on your
stereo, then press Scroll Left ( )
or Scroll Right ( ) until the
stereo changes to SAT input.
9.
Press OK to save the input.
NOTE: Some stereos do not have
discrete input selections, but
instead use a single input select
to cycle through all available
inputs. If your stereo operates in
this way, simply use the INPUT
key (below digit 7 on the wireless
controller) to cycle to the
appropriate audio input for Sirius.
10. The wireless controller displays
YOUR INPUT IS NOW PROGRAMMED
PUSH OK TO EXIT.
11. The wireless controller displays
SIRIUS Key Now Automatically
Changes Input.
You can now use your SIRIUS
wireless controller to control your
stereo's volume whenever you press
Volume+, Volume–, or MUTE on the
controller while you're in SIRIUS
mode.
SIRIUS Conductor Tuner
Using the
Key and the
POWER Key to Turn Your
Devices On or Off
You can use the
key on your
SIRIUS wireless controller to turn on
your SIRIUS Conductor, or the
POWER key to turn it off.
When you press
, the wireless
controller enters SIRIUS mode and
turns on your SIRIUS radio. Once you
have programmed the audio sources
as described previously, the
also transmits power to your audio
device and controls its volume. By
pressing one key, you can turn your
SIRIUS radio and your stereo or other
audio device on or off, while remaining
in SIRIUS mode so you can access all
the features of your satellite radio.
NOTE: If you change any settings for
your Audio Device, you must follow
the steps for Audio Source
programming again to save the
changes.
SIRIUS Modes of
Operation

Normal Mode

When you first turn on your radio, the
LCD displays the Normal Operation
(Default) screen. The screen displays
the last channel selected before
shutdown, the artist's name, the
channel number, and the radio band
information.
001
CH NAME
Artist Name
Song Title
NOTE: If the artist name or song title
is too long to fit the screen, it
scrolls across the screen from
right to left.
